While some people consider seafood meals worthy of devouring, others only see a pungent dish of confusing flavors. But with the right cooking methods and a little creativity, it’s easy to convert any nay-sayer into a believer. Here are 20 simple seafood dishes that even picky eaters will love.

1. Seafood Pizza

Seafood pizza is a smooth transition for any picky eater. Topping a well-loved dinner option with seafood like shrimp, scallops, or crab gives nay-sayers the best of both worlds. All that cheese and sauce can help disguise any new flavors, too.

2. Clam Chowder

Chowder often scares away picky eaters (we think it’s the name), but it’s so much more than a bowl of fish. Clams are combined with potatoes, onions, bacon, and a creamy broth for the ultimate comfort food. Sure, it tastes a little fishy, but it’s part of a perfect medley.

4. Stuffed Peppers

Picky eaters have a much easier time accepting new food when it’s mixed in something else, especially flavors they know and love. That said, swap out lean beef for tuna with this seafood spin! Tuna is far more inviting when combined with rice, cheese, and seasoning.

13. Fish Tacos

Mild white fish often go farther with picky eaters, so use cod or tilapia for this dish. Stuffed between soft tortillas and then slathered in tangy sauce? Even the pickiest of eaters won’t find much to complain about.
